Class CalendarException
Именује се: Aspose.Tasks Асамблеја: Aspose.Tasks.dll (25.4.0)
Представљају изузетне временске периоде у календару.
[ClassInterface(ClassInterfaceType.AutoDual)]
public sealed class CalendarException
Inheritance
Наслеђени чланови
object.GetType()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Constructors
CalendarException()
Иницијалише нову инстанцију Аппосе.Таскс.КалендарСлужбене класе.
public CalendarException()
Properties
DayWorking
Добија или поставља вредност која указује на то да ли одређени датум или тип дана ради.
public bool DayWorking { get; set; }
Вредност имовине
DaysOfWeek
Добијте DayTypeCollection за овај објекат.Дани недеље у којима је изузетак важећи.
public DayTypeCollection DaysOfWeek { get; }
Вредност имовине
EnteredByOccurrences
Добија или поставља вредност која указује на то да ли је опсег понављања дефинисан увођењем броја догађаја.Фалс наводи да се опсег понављања дефинише уношењем датума завршетка.
public bool EnteredByOccurrences { get; set; }
Вредност имовине
FromDate
Добија или поставља почетак изванредног времена.
public DateTime FromDate { get; set; }
Вредност имовине
Month
Добије или одређује месец за који је планирано понављање изузетка.
public Month Month { get; set; }
Вредност имовине
MonthDay
Добија или одређује дан месеца у којем се планира понављање изузетка.
public int MonthDay { get; set; }
Вредност имовине
MonthItem
Добијете или постављате мјесечни став за који је планиран понављање изузетка.
public MonthItemType MonthItem { get; set; }
Вредност имовине
MonthPosition
Добија или поставља позицију мјесечног предмета у року од месец дана.
public MonthPosition MonthPosition { get; set; }
Вредност имовине
Name
Добије или поставља име изузетак.
public string Name { get; set; }
Вредност имовине
Occurrences
Добија или одређује број догађаја за које је календарска изузетак важећа.
public int Occurrences { get; set; }
Вредност имовине
ParentCalendar
Добијте родни календар за овај објекат.
public Calendar ParentCalendar { get; }
Вредност имовине
Period
Добија или одређује период понављања за изузетак.
public int Period { get; set; }
Вредност имовине
ToDate
Добија или поставља крај изванредног времена.
public DateTime ToDate { get; set; }
Вредност имовине
Type
Добија или поставља изванредни тип.
public CalendarExceptionType Type { get; set; }
Вредност имовине
WorkingTimes
Добија или поставља објекат WorkingTimeCollection.Сакупљање радног времена које дефинише време рађено у недељном дану.
public WorkingTimeCollection WorkingTimes { get; set; }
Вредност имовине
Methods
CheckException(DateTime)
Враћа се истинито ако је одређена инстанција Систем.Датум структуре дан изузетка.
public bool CheckException(DateTime dt)
Parameters
dt
DateTime
одређена инстанција Систем.Датум структуре.
Returns
Враћа се истинито ако је вредност System.DateTime изванредни дан; иначе, лажна.
Delete()
Избрисање Изузетак из родног календара КалендарИзузетакКоллекција објекат.
public void Delete()
GetExceptionDates()
Повратак датума на које се примењује календарска изузетак.
public IEnumerable<datetime> GetExceptionDates()
Returns
IEnumerable < DateTime >
Повратак прикупљања изузеци датума за које се примењује календарска изузетак.
GetWorkingTime()
Повратак радног времена за календарску изузетак.
public TimeSpan GetWorkingTime()
Returns
Враћа радно време за овај календарски изузетак.